Engineering aircraft maintenance training usually takes around two to three years to complete. The exact duration may vary depending on the training structure and learning stages. This time allows students to understand aircraft systems, safety procedures, and maintenance methods step by step. Since aircraft technology is complex, proper training time is important for building strong technical knowledge.
The training of engineering aircraft maintenance includes both classroom learning and practical experience. In the classroom, students study subjects such as aircraft structure, aerodynamics, engines, avionics systems, and maintenance procedures. These subjects help students understand how aircraft systems operate and how problems can be detected.
Practical training is also an important part of the program. Students observe real aircraft systems and learn how maintenance inspections are performed. This practical exposure helps them apply theoretical knowledge in real situations and develop technical confidence.
During the training period, students develop technical skills, problem-solving ability, and knowledge of aviation safety standards. They learn how to inspect aircraft parts, identify faults, and follow proper maintenance procedures.
